Two years at San José State after transferring from the University of Portland…Academic All-Mountain West honoree…one of 10 student-athletes chosen to represent San José State at the Black Student-Athlete Summit in May 2022.
2022 Season
- Starter at middle blocker
 - Averaged 1.59 kills and 1.05 blocks per set in 103 sets played
 - 14 kills at Utah State to lead the team
 - 10+ kills in four matches
 - Hit .313 for the season
 - Best match was .714 at Fresno State (10-0-14)
 - Added .667 at New Mexico (6-0-9) and .533 at Wyoming (8-0-15)
 - Three digs in four matches
 - Led the Spartans in blocking with 109, 21 solo and 88 assists
 - Team-best nine blocks at Boise State, two solo and seven assists
 - Three solo blocks at Colorado State and two solo blocks in six matches
 - Seven blocks in a loss to San Diego State (2-5)
 - Five blocks against New Mexico twice (2-3)
 - Five block assists in four matches
